Ethiopia's poverty headcount, national (%) was 33.1% in 2021, ranking #28 out of 104 countries. This represents a +40.9% change from 2015. Over the past 4 years, the highest recorded value was 38.7% (2004) and the lowest was 23.5% (2015). Data sourced from the World Bank World Development Indicators.
